‘New Education Policy envisages changes in curriculum’

Show comments

Tribune News Service

Ludhiana, February 23

Sri Aurobindo College of Commerce and Management organised a lecture on the New Education Policy for the New higher Education-2019 under the guidance of Principal Prof Ajay Sharma and Director Dr Sushil Kumar.

Prof Karamjit Singh, Registrar, Panjab University, Chandigarh, was invited as a keynote speaker for the session. He enlightened the members of the faculty with regard to the transformations that would be brought into the higher education sector after the introduction of ‘New Education policy’.

He stated that the policy envisages a new curricular and pedagogical structure for higher education that is responsive and is relevant to the needs and interests of learners at different stages of development. Members of the faculty showed their enthusiasm and had an interactive session.
